首页 > 生活百科 > 数据库设计规范(数据库设计规范)

数据库设计规范(数据库设计规范)

数据库设计规范

引言

数据库设计是软件开发过程中至关重要的一环。良好的数据库设计可以提高系统的稳定性、性能以及扩展性。为了确保数据库设计的质量,开发团队应该遵循一系列的数据库设计规范。本文将介绍一些常用的数据库设计规范,以帮助开发团队在数据库设计过程中达到最佳实践。

一、命名规范

为了提高数据库对象的可读性和可维护性,命名规范是至关重要的。以下是一些常用的命名规范:

1. 表名

- 表名应该使用小写字母。 - 使用下划线作为单词之间的分隔符,例如\"employee_info\"。 - 避免使用数据库关键字作为表名。

2. 字段名

- 字段名也应使用小写字母。 - 使用下划线作为单词之间的分隔符。 - 字段名应该具有描述性,尽量避免使用缩写。 - 避免使用数据库保留字作为字段名。

3. 约束名

- 约束名应使用大写字母。 - 约束名应具有描述性,能够准确表达其作用。

二、数据类型选择

合理选择适当的数据类型对数据库性能和存储空间的优化非常重要。以下是一些常用的数据类型选择规范:

1. 整数类型

- 如果字段的取值范围在-32,768和32,767之间,可以选择\"SMALLINT\"。 - 如果字段的取值范围在-2,147,483,648和2,147,483,647之间,可以选择\"INT\"。 - 如果字段的取值范围大于2,147,483,647,可以选择\"BIGINT\"。

2. 字符串类型

- 对于较短的字符串,可以选择\"VARCHAR\"类型,并指定最大长度。 - 对于较长的字符串,可以选择\"TEXT\"类型。

3. 浮点数类型

- 根据精度的要求,可以选择\"FLOAT\"或\"DOUBLE\"类型。

三、表结构设计

合理的表结构设计可以提高数据库的性能和可维护性。以下是一些常用的表结构设计规范:

1. 主键

- 每个表应该定义一个主键来唯一标识每一行数据。 - 主键应该是简洁、稳定的。 - 常用的主键选择包括自增整数、全局唯一标识符(GUID)等。

2. 外键

- 外键用于建立表之间的关联关系。 - 外键应该与相关联的主键的数据类型和长度一致。 - 确保外键的引用完整性,可以使用“ON DELETE CASCADE”等相关约束。

3. 索引

- 为经常使用的字段创建索引,以提高查询性能。 - 避免过多的索引,以减少数据的插入和更新时的性能损失。

数据库设计规范对于软件开发过程中的成功至关重要。通过遵循命名规范、数据类型选择和表结构设计等规范,可以提高数据库的可读性、可维护性和性能。开发团队应根据项目的具体要求,制定一套适合自己的数据库设计规范,并在开发过程中严格遵循。
版权声明:《数据库设计规范(数据库设计规范)》文章主要来源于网络,不代表本网站立场,不承担相关法律责任,如涉及版权问题,请发送邮件至3237157959@qq.com举报,我们会在第一时间进行处理。本文文章链接:http://www.wxitmall.com/shenghuobk/23518.html

数据库设计规范(数据库设计规范)的相关推荐